FIFA to investigate a ‘series of incidents’ around England and Scotland poppy displays

FIFA is considering far wider charges against the English and Scottish Football Associations than simply the wearing of armbands with poppies on them during last week's World Cup qualifier at Wembley.

Players from both teams wore the armbands despite being warned by FIFA that it would contravene an International Football Association Board (IFAB) rule against equipment with commercial, personal, political or religious logos or messages.
